đ⨠Tonight's the night for an epic "Parade of Planets" with seven planets putting on a show just after sunset. đ đ Venus will be your guide to spotting the rest of the lineup, which includes Mercury, Uranus, Neptune, Mars, Jupiter, and Saturn.
But here's the catch â seeing all seven won't be a walk in the park. đ Mercury and Saturn are playing hard to get, hiding close to the sun's glare. đđ According to Shannon Schmoll from Michigan State University, you'll need a clear view of the western horizon and maybe some binoculars to catch them.
So grab your stargazing gear and head outside at dusk! đ⨠You might only spot four or five, but it's still a sight to behold. And remember, this planetary parade won't happen again until 2040, so don't miss out! đ đ
